🎙 How the Mind Works — Association, Memory & Mental NoiseIn this episode, I break down how the mind isn’t really ours—at least not in the way we think. What we call my mind is mostly a collection of borrowed thoughts, past associations, and inherited beliefs. The mind works through connections—linking memories and labels to every moment—and this often leads to confusion, division, and mental chaos.I share how many of us unconsciously took sides during childhood, forming identities based on incomplete information. These mental alliances now shape how we judge, react, and even suffer.But there’s another way.I explain how we can use the mind as a tool—a loyal servant—rather than be misled by it as a false leader. I also offer a simple, practical approach to quieting the mind:🧘♂️ Deliberately return to the present.⚖️ Stay neutral. Stop taking sides.Whether your mind feels noisy, overwhelmed, or stuck in the past, this episode will help you see it more clearly—and perhaps for the first time, choose peace over patterns.
